Does VBA do until loop?
A Do… Until loop is used when we want to repeat a set of statements as long as the condition is false. The condition may be checked at the beginning of the loop or at the end of loop.
What is the purpose of On Error Resume Next in VB net?
On Error Resume Next – whenever an error occurred in runtime , skip the statement and continue execution on following statements.
What is the purpose of On Error Resume Next?
On Error Resume Next This statement allows execution to continue despite a run-time error. You can place the error-handling routine where the error would occur rather than transferring control to another location within the procedure.
What is a syntax error in VBA?
A syntax error, as the name suggests, occurs when VBA finds something wrong with the syntax in the code. For example, if you forget a part of the statement/syntax that is needed, then you will see the compile error. This is because the IF statement needs to have the ‘Then’ command, which is missing in the below code.
What are the three ways to run a Visual Basic application?
There are several ways to run your program:
- Press the F5 key.
- On the VB menu bar, Run > Start.
- On the VB toolbar, click the VB Run icon (the arrow)
What is the role of error trapping and handling?
Error trapping refers to the prediction, finding and fixing of programming errors. Even with the best efforts taken to reduce errors, there will be times when errors are made in a program. Many programming languages provide error trapping facilities for such situations.
What are the steps in building a Visual Basic application?
Creating Your First Program in Visual Basic
- Step 1: Download Visual Basic.
- Step 2: Create Your Project.
- Step 3: Add Controls.
- Step 4: Edit Control Properties.
- Step 5: Add Code.
- Step 6: Save and Test.
- Step 7: Final Thoughts.
- 50 Comments.
What is the difference between TextBox and label control?
Hi. In terms of Visual Studio Windows Form Applications, A Label is a control which is used to display some text onto the form whereas, A TextBox control is used to input data from the user.
What is the difference between list box and combo box?
The List box displays all the items at once in a text area, whereas the combo box displays only one item at a time. The Combo box is a combination of a text box in which the user enters an item and a drop-down list from which the user selects an item.
How do you write codes in Visual Basic?
Create a “Calculate This” application
- Open Visual Studio 2017, and then from the top menu bar, choose File > New > Project.
- In the New Project dialog box in the left pane, expand Visual Basic, and then choose .
- Enter the following code between the Module Program line and End Module line:
Is VBA worth learning?
So no, learning VBA is not useless. It’s a really useful language and will likely be a central part of Excel for many years. That being said, you can always learn another language.
How do I start VBA code?
Insert VBA code to Excel Workbook
- Open your workbook in Excel.
- Press Alt + F11 to open Visual Basic Editor (VBE).
- Right-click on your workbook name in the “Project-VBAProject” pane (at the top left corner of the editor window) and select Insert -> Module from the context menu.
- Copy the VBA code (from a web-page etc.)
Is Visual Basic still used 2020?
Microsoft said this week that it will support Visual Basic on . NET 5.0 but will no longer add new features or evolve the language.
Will VBA be discontinued?
VBA will never completely go away because too many companies have invested in it. Microsoft will continue to push JavaScript APIs as the new VBA replacement across all it’s platforms (PC, Mac, Tablet, Browser) VBA is still something that should be learned and can easily differentiate you from other Excel users.
Is VBA going away?
Conclusion. With tools that are available within Excel, such as Power Query as well as the tools that exist within the Power Platform, the number of use cases for VBA is declining. Business users will still seek VBA based solutions, but this is primarily due to: Lack of permission provided by IT departments.
Is Python better than Visual Basic?
In the question“What is the best programming language to learn first?” Python is ranked 1st while Visual Basic is ranked 65th. The most important reason people chose Python is: Python’s popularity and beginner friendliness has led to a wealth of tutorials and example code on the internet.
Can Python replace VBA?
Yes, absolutely! VBA is commonly used to automate Excel with macros, add new user defined worksheet functions (UDFs) and react to Excel events. Everything you would previously have done in Excel using VBA can be achieved with Python.
Is Python faster than VBA?
More so, for non-intensive mathematical operations where speed is very important, VBA is faster as you would spend significant extra coding time to use Python. However, for intensive mathematical operations, Python offers a fairly easy-to-use and efficient compiled code that is faster than VBA.
Does anyone use Visual Basic anymore?
No, it’s fifth most popular programming language. Visual Basic . Net might not be the coolest programming language to know, but it remains popular and has now reached its highest position on the Tiobe index of top programming languages.
Is it worth it to learn Visual Basic in 2020?
No, sadly – you have better options for learning a new language. Long-term evolution of Visual Studio appears to be focused on C#. And Python has largely eclipsed VB as an accessible general purpose language. VB will be around for a while, but you’ll find more uses, across more platforms, with other languages.
What has replaced Visual Basic?
NET (VB.NET)
Is C# better than Visual Basic?
Even though there is less prominence of VB.NET community, but still we can say VB.NET is better than C#. 1. VB.NET uses implicit casting and makes it easier to code whereas in C# there are lot of casting and conversions needs to be done for the same lines of code. It is easier to Re-dimension arrays in VB than in C#.
Is C# a dying language?
C# is an important language in the AR/VR (Hololens) and game developer ecosystems, but it seems to be losing its edge in desktop development — possibly due to the emergence of cross-platform tools based on web technologies,” says the “Developer Economics: State of the Developer Nation 18th Edition,” covering the …
What is the future of Visual Basic?
“Visual Basic is a great language and a productive development environment. The future of Visual Basic will include both . NET Framework and . NET Core and will focus on stability, the application types listed above, and compatibility between the .
Does VB Net have a future?
Though there may be a lot of new technologies emerging in the market, thinking to convert these projects into updated trends is not an easy task. It requires a lot of effort, time, and money for that. Therefore, it is quite clear to say – VB.Net is not going to vanish in the market in the upcoming future.